well this weekend i got my 1.5 inch roger brown lift installed. installation took a while (9 hours total) but no major problems. thanks a lot to andy (alee27) for all his help.
then today i had a special bracket made so i could fit the crush bumper (not sure if it's called that, but that metal bumber under the exterior bumper) and grille guard would fit with the body lift. i still have to get some gap guards.
and last week i did the maglite mod so i have a full size flashlight in the back help up with a maglite clip.
so here are a couple pictures.
i still have to drop the radiator 1.5 inches, and maybe extend the 4wd shifter so it won't sit so low on the inside.
and i'm going to see if i can just enlarge the holes in back bumper so the spare tire will still be accessible with that key that lowers it.
also, deckplate mod....i hope to get that done next week.
